v0.27.0: detect AACS-scrambled units by raw TS sync, not flag bits
Rename is_unit_encrypted -> is_aacs_scrambled and decide encryption from the unit's MPEG-TS sync bytes (destroyed by the encrypted body) instead of the TP_extra copy-control (byte 0) or TS scrambling-control (byte 7) flags, which discs do not set reliably. One shared predicate now backs the decrypt gate and out-of-band key validation, so callers agree on what 'encrypted' means. Decryption restores the syncs, so a decrypted unit reads as clear and there is no flag to clear.
